O que é OpenID Connect e para que serve?

O que é OpenID Connect?

OpenID Connect é um protocolo de autenticação que se baseia no OAuth 2.0, permitindo que os usuários façam login em diferentes serviços online utilizando uma única identidade digital. Este sistema simplifica o processo de autenticação, eliminando a necessidade de criar e gerenciar múltiplas senhas para diferentes plataformas. Com o OpenID Connect, os usuários podem acessar uma variedade de aplicativos e serviços com um único conjunto de credenciais, aumentando a conveniência e a segurança.

Como funciona o OpenID Connect?

O funcionamento do OpenID Connect envolve a troca de informações entre o provedor de identidade e o aplicativo que deseja autenticar o usuário. Quando um usuário tenta acessar um serviço que utiliza OpenID Connect, ele é redirecionado para o provedor de identidade, onde insere suas credenciais. Após a autenticação, o provedor envia um token de ID de volta ao aplicativo, que pode ser usado para verificar a identidade do usuário e obter informações adicionais, como nome e e-mail.

Para que serve o OpenID Connect?

O OpenID Connect serve principalmente para simplificar o processo de autenticação em ambientes digitais. Ele é amplamente utilizado em aplicativos web e móveis, permitindo que os desenvolvedores integrem facilmente a autenticação de usuários sem a necessidade de gerenciar senhas. Além disso, o protocolo oferece uma camada adicional de segurança, pois os dados de autenticação são gerenciados por um provedor confiável, reduzindo o risco de vazamentos de informações sensíveis.

Vantagens do OpenID Connect

Uma das principais vantagens do OpenID Connect é a melhoria na experiência do usuário. Com a possibilidade de usar uma única identidade para acessar múltiplos serviços, os usuários não precisam se lembrar de várias senhas, o que reduz a frustração e o abandono de processos de login. Além disso, o OpenID Connect promove a segurança, pois os provedores de identidade geralmente implementam medidas robustas de proteção, como autenticação multifator.

Diferença entre OpenID e OpenID Connect

Embora OpenID e OpenID Connect compartilhem a mesma finalidade de autenticação, eles diferem em sua arquitetura e funcionalidades. O OpenID original era um protocolo mais simples, que permitia apenas a autenticação básica. Por outro lado, o OpenID Connect é mais avançado, oferecendo recursos adicionais, como a capacidade de obter informações do perfil do usuário e suporte para fluxos de autenticação mais complexos, tornando-o mais adequado para aplicações modernas.

Implementação do OpenID Connect

A implementação do OpenID Connect em um aplicativo envolve a configuração de um provedor de identidade e a integração do protocolo no código do aplicativo. Os desenvolvedores precisam seguir as especificações do OpenID Connect para garantir que a autenticação funcione corretamente. Existem várias bibliotecas e frameworks disponíveis que facilitam essa integração, permitindo que os desenvolvedores se concentrem em outras partes do aplicativo.

OpenID Connect e segurança

A segurança é uma preocupação central no OpenID Connect. O protocolo utiliza tokens de acesso e tokens de ID, que são assinados digitalmente, garantindo que as informações não possam ser alteradas por terceiros. Além disso, o OpenID Connect suporta autenticação multifator, o que adiciona uma camada extra de proteção contra acessos não autorizados. Essas características fazem do OpenID Connect uma escolha popular para aplicações que exigem um alto nível de segurança.

Casos de uso do OpenID Connect

O OpenID Connect é amplamente utilizado em diversos cenários, como em plataformas de redes sociais, serviços de e-commerce e aplicativos corporativos. Por exemplo, muitos sites permitem que os usuários se registrem e façam login usando suas contas do Google ou Facebook, que atuam como provedores de identidade. Isso não apenas simplifica o processo de registro, mas também aumenta a confiança dos usuários, pois eles estão utilizando serviços reconhecidos.

Futuro do OpenID Connect

O futuro do OpenID Connect parece promissor, especialmente com o aumento da digitalização e da necessidade de soluções de autenticação seguras. À medida que mais empresas adotam a nuvem e serviços digitais, a demanda por protocolos de autenticação eficientes e seguros continuará a crescer. O OpenID Connect, com sua flexibilidade e robustez, está bem posicionado para atender a essas necessidades, tornando-se um padrão de fato para autenticação em ambientes online.

Ao realizar compras através dos links presentes em nosso site, podemos receber uma comissão de afiliado, sem que isso gere custos extras para você!

Sobre nós

Computação e Informática

Este site oferece informações e recomendações de produtos de tecnologia, como computadores, componentes de hardware, periféricos e soluções de armazenamento.

Você pode ter perdido

  • All Posts
  • Armazenamento
  • Componentes de Hardware
  • FAQ
  • Notebooks e PCs
  • Periféricos
  • Software e Aplicativos
© 2025 Computação e Informática | Portal Ikenet